Caution 
1. When replacing the lamp, avoid burns to your  fingers, the lamp becomes very hot.
2. Never touch the lamp bulb with a  fi nger or anything else. Never drop it or give it a shock. They may 
cause bursting of the bulb.
3. This projector is provided with a high voltage circuit for the lamp. Do not touch the electric parts of 
power unit (circuit) and power unit (ballast), after turn on the projector.
4. Do not touch the exhaust fan, during operation.
5. The LCD module assembly is likely to be damaged. If replacing the LCD LENS/PRISM assembly, 
do not hold the FPC of the LCD module assembly.
6. Use the cables which are included with the projector or specifi ed.
